For a hypothetical tetrahedral complex [ML₄]²⁻ , the crystal field splitting energy ( _t ) is 4000 cm ⁻¹ . The crystal field splitting energy ( _o ) for the corresponding octahedral complex [ML₆]⁴⁻ with the same metal and ligands will be
Options
- A1777 cm ⁻¹
- B4000 cm ⁻¹
- C8000 cm ⁻¹
- D9000 cm ⁻¹
Correct answer
D. 9000 cm ⁻¹
Step-by-step solution
The relationship between the crystal field splitting energy of a tetrahedral complex ( _t ) and an octahedral complex ( _o ) having the same metal, the same oxidation state, and the same ligands is given by: _t = 4 9 _o Rearranging the formula to solve for _o gives: _o = 9 4 _t Substituting the given value of _t = 4000 cm ⁻¹ : _o = 9 4 4000 cm ⁻¹ = 9000 cm ⁻¹ Answer: 9000 cm ⁻¹
